Blumentals wrote:Sometimes it is necessary to place a text or an image (e.g. your name or your logo) on all frames. Professional edition allows to do this with a single click.


I have just up-graded to EGA 4 Pro (version 4.6) in order that I can add a single image to every frame but cannot for the life of me figure out how?

Can you help please?

Thanks! :)

Postby Karlis » Thu Mar 13, 2008 2:09 pm

Paste the new image on the current frame and click the button [Copy Selection to All Frames] at the top of the editing area (only available when there is a selection).

Postby Karlis » Sat Mar 29, 2008 5:55 pm

Do you have Easy GIF Animator Standard or Pro? This is only available in the Professional version.

In the image editor simply with your mouse select any area of your current frame. At the top of the image editor you should be able to see buttons Select All, Center in Frame and Copy Selection to All Frames.

These buttons are visible only when there is a selection and they are located right under Edit / preview tabs.
